Ariba Guided Buying is a cloud-based procurement solution created by SAP Ariba to help organizations better manage their spend and streamline their purchasing processes. With Ariba Guided Buying, companies can simplify the buying experience for their employees while ensuring compliance with corporate policies and preferred suppliers. Key Features of Ariba Guided Buying
Ariba Guided Buying offers a range of features that empower users to make informed purchasing decisions efficiently. Some of the key features of Ariba Guided Buying include:
1. Consumer-like Shopping Experience: Ariba Guided Buying provides an intuitive shopping interface that resembles popular e-commerce platforms. Users can easily browse catalog items, compare prices, and place orders with just a few clicks.
2. Guided Buying Assistance: The solution guides users through the purchasing process by suggesting items based on their preferences, previous purchases, and company policies. This feature helps improve user adoption and compliance with procurement guidelines.
3. Policy Enforcement: Ariba Guided Buying allows organizations to enforce their procurement policies and approval workflows. This ensures that all purchases are in line with company guidelines and are made from approved suppliers.
4. Supplier Integration: Ariba Guided Buying integrates seamlessly with SAP Ariba’s supplier network, enabling users to access a wide range of suppliers and negotiate favorable terms. This integration streamlines the procurement process and helps organizations achieve cost savings.
5. Analytics and Reporting: Ariba Guided Buying provides real-time analytics and reporting tools that offer insights into spending patterns, supplier performance, and compliance levels. This data-driven approach helps organizations identify opportunities for improvement and make data-driven decisions.

Implementation of Ariba Guided Buying
Implementing Ariba Guided Buying is a straightforward process that can be tailored to meet the specific needs of an organization. The implementation typically involves the following steps:
1. Planning and Assessment: The first step in implementing Ariba Guided Buying is to assess the organization’s procurement processes, identify areas for improvement, and define the project scope. This helps ensure that the implementation aligns with the organization’s goals and objectives.
2. Configuration and Customization: Ariba Guided Buying can be configured and customized to meet the unique requirements of an organization. This may involve setting up catalog items, defining approval workflows, and integrating with existing systems.
3. Training and Change Management: To ensure a successful implementation, organizations should provide training to users on how to use Ariba Guided Buying effectively. Additionally, change management strategies should be put in place to help employees adapt to the new procurement processes.
4. Monitoring and Optimization: Once Ariba Guided Buying has been implemented, organizations should continuously monitor its performance, gather feedback from users, and optimize the system to improve efficiency and user satisfaction.
